Cowboy Soup

Cowboy Soup is a hearty dish that combines turkey bacon and chicken ham for a delightful meal.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 slices turkey bacon
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 3 cups chicken broth
  • 1 can corn, drained
  • 1 can kidney beans, drained and rinsed
  • 2 cups cooked chicken ham, diced
  • 1 tablespoon taco seasoning
  • 2 cups mixed vegetables
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, cook turkey bacon until crispy. Remove and crumble.
  2. Sauté onion and garlic in the same pot until translucent.
  3. Add diced tomatoes, chicken broth, corn, kidney beans, cooked chicken ham, and taco seasoning. Stir well.
  4. Bring the soup to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es.
  5. Add mixed vegetables and cook for another 10 minutes.
  6.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Serve hot, garnished with crumbled turkey bacon.

Notes

  • For a spicier kick, add jalapeños.
  • Can substitute turkey bacon with regular bacon if preferred.
